Deepfakes, those hyperrealistic AI-generated videos and images manipulating reality, pose a growing threat to accurate information and civil discourse. But users in India will soon have a powerful tool to combat them: a dedicated WhatsApp Helpline for reporting misinformation and deepfakes.

This initiative, announced by Meta and the Misinformation Combat Alliance (MCA), marks a significant step in tackling the spread of harmful AI content. Here’s how it works:

Reporting Made Easy:

whatsapp favourite contacts
  • Any user can flag suspicious content within WhatsApp itself using the Helpline’s chatbot interface.
  • The chatbot, available in English, Hindi, Tamil, and Telugu, simplifies reporting, making it accessible to a wider audience.

Deepfake Analysis Unit:

WhatsApp
  • A central unit, set up by MCA, will analyze reported content in collaboration with fact-checking member organizations.
  • This ensures thorough verification and debunking of misinformation and deepfakes.

Four-Pillar Approach:

WhatsApp
  • The initiative focuses on four key pillars:
    • Detection: Identifying and analyzing potentially harmful content.
    • Prevention: Educating users about deepfakes and misinformation tactics.
    • Reporting: Creating a user-friendly reporting mechanism.
    • Awareness: Raising public understanding of the risks and impact of deepfakes.

Additional Measures:

whatsapp on tv
  • WhatsApp already allows flagging messages to IFCN fact-checkers and following dedicated fact-checking channels for verified information.
  • It limits message forwarding to curb the spread of misinformation.

Launch and Impact:

Dual Whatsapp
  • The Helpline is expected to be available by March 2024, empowering users to become active participants in fighting misinformation.
  • Improved accessibility to reliable information and efficient debunking of deepfakes will foster a healthier online environment in India.
